    Lip fillers have become a popular cosmetic procedure for enhancing the appearance of lips, but for many in Geelong, the question of whether they are halal is significant. Halal refers to practices that are permissible under Islamic law, and this includes medical and cosmetic procedures.

    In general, lip fillers that are made from substances such as hyaluronic acid, which is derived from non-animal sources, are considered halal. These fillers are biocompatible and do not involve the use of animal-derived products, making them acceptable for those following Islamic dietary and medical guidelines.

    However, it is crucial to verify the ingredients and the process used by the clinic or practitioner in Geelong. Some fillers may contain traces of animal products or be processed using animal-based methods, which would not be considered halal. Therefore, it is advisable to consult with a knowledgeable healthcare provider or a religious authority to ensure that the chosen lip filler procedure aligns with halal principles.

    In summary, lip fillers can be halal in Geelong if they are composed of non-animal derived substances and are administered in a manner that adheres to Islamic guidelines. Always seek professional advice to make an informed decision.

    Understanding Lip Fillers and Their Religious Implications

    Lip fillers have become increasingly popular in Geelong and around the world for enhancing facial features and achieving a more youthful appearance. However, for many individuals, particularly those adhering to Islamic principles, the question of whether these procedures are permissible under Islamic law is of utmost importance.

    The Islamic Perspective on Medical Procedures

    Islamic jurisprudence generally allows medical treatments that are necessary for maintaining health and well-being. Cosmetic procedures, including lip fillers, fall into a gray area. The key consideration is whether the procedure is deemed necessary or purely for aesthetic purposes. If the procedure is seen as enhancing natural beauty without causing harm, it may be considered permissible.

    Ingredients and Their Halal Status

    The primary concern with lip fillers from an Islamic perspective is the composition of the filler materials. Most lip fillers use hyaluronic acid, a substance naturally found in the body, which is generally considered halal. However, it is crucial to ensure that the product is free from any animal-derived components or other substances that could be considered haram. Consulting with a knowledgeable healthcare provider who is aware of these considerations can help ensure that the chosen product is compliant with Islamic dietary laws.
